When I was young I had to try,
To break away, I had to try,
To leave the nest, or know I'd die...........................I'd go.

And then I saw my true love's eyes,
Like burning coals, my true love's eyes,
And then I heard my mother's cries.....................Don't go.

And as I watched the world go by,
I looked and saw our fathers die,
And I could hear the children cry........................Don't go.

But then my love turned cold as ice,
As white as snow, as cold as ice,
She slipped from me that wintry night......She's gone.

And when I saw my true love die,
Grow pale, then blue, and then she died,
O I could hear the mountains cry.....................She's gone.

But I'd have died a thousand times,
For you, my love, a thousand times,
To give you life, I'd give you mine........................I'd go.

Yet still today the mountains sigh,
The oceans roar, the willows cry,
And in my heart I know that I.......................................am gone.
